The Role
Moderna is seeking an Associate Director of Communications to lead integrated communications activities and help increase visibility for its science, business and reputation as a good corporate citizen and top employer, both internally and externally. This individual will work within the Brand & Corporate Affairs team and engage directly with leaders across the organization. We are seeking a candidate who can succeed in a fast-paced and highly collaborative environment, while also being self-motivated and able to work independently.


They will have excellent written and verbal communications skills; be fluent in social and digital communications engagement and strategy; have experience managing agencies and vendors; and be comfortable working with corporate and program teams across a complex organization and multiple sites and geographies. In addition, they will help develop and manage a range of initiatives, including the creation and execution of internal communications plans, corporate reputation activities and community and employee engagement programs that support our global workforce, dynamic culture and commitment to corporate social responsibility.


The role will be based in Cambridge, MA and will report to the Vice President of Corporate Affairs and work closely with the Director of Corporate Affairs.


Heres What Youll Do

  • Oversee the development and implementation of internal and external communications strategies, programs and materials, engaging directly with internal and external stakeholders.

  • Collaborate across the organization to create internal resources and communications channels, helping employees connect to the companys science, platform, business, and each other.

  • Partner with internal departments to create and implement effective campaigns that support employee engagement, change management and recruiting. Seek opportunities to celebrate and promote internal partners news and success stories and Moderna as a top employer.

  • Work with internal groups to drive company education, belonging, inclusion and diversity programs, corporate responsibility efforts, and community outreach and engagement.

  • Establish and maintain relationships with HR partners to support Modernas employer brand and related internal and external communications.

  • Assist with town hall meetings, webcasts, podcasts, and other internal programs and employee initiatives.

  • Ensure alignment between internal and external communications messaging by partnering with other communications leaders.

  • Help maintain the companys internal digital platforms and social media channels.

  • Increase awareness and visibility of Modernas leadership in mRNA science, platform, pipeline, technology and commitment to corporate responsibility and being an employer of choice.

About Moderna

Since our founding in 2010, we have aspired to build the leading mRNA technology platform, theinfrastructure to reimagine how medicines are created and delivered, and a world-class team. We believe in giving our people a platform to change medicine and an opportunity to change the world.

By living our mission, values, and mindsets every day, our peopleare the driving force behind our scientific progress and our culture.Together, we are creating a culture of belonging and building an organization that cares deeply for our patients, our employees, the environment, and our communities.
We are proud to have been recognized as a Science Magazine Top Biopharma Employer, a Fast Company Best Workplace for Innovators, and a Great Place to Work in the U.S.
